Output 56ec332e00a687e8ec9d8065fea2a382bfea784a67ec4fcd827df01c07ed5cb1:1

value
1637766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7bb390150d2e028444489c2b3910085d69d09c5 OP_EQUAL
address
3Ku6gBFjuWA3q8fxkzcPU4aiMHMW2rb5oJ
transaction
56ec332e00a687e8ec9d8065fea2a382bfea784a67ec4fcd827df01c07ed5cb1
confirmations
298849
spent
true